PINEAPPLE GINGER MUFFINS



Pineapple Ginger Muffins image

Provided by Sharon

Categories     Dessert     Snack

Time 35m

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 1/4 cups spelt flour
1/4 cup ground flax
1 1/2 tsp baking soda
1/2 tsp salt
1 tsp ground ginger
1/2 cup maple syrup
2 tbsp. coconut oil (melted)
2 tsp vanilla
2/3 cup Greek yogurt (or sour cream)
1 egg
1 1/2 cups diced (fresh pineapple (or thawed from frozen))

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 and line a 12 cup muffin tin with parchment liners
  • In a large bowl, whisk together the flour, ground flax, baking soda, salt and ground ginger. Set aside
  • In another bowl, whisk together the maple syrup, Greek yogurt, vanilla and egg. Set aside and let it come to room temp before adding the coconut oil. You want the oil to remain liquid. Whisk in the coconut oil. Add the liquid to the dry and stir until just combined. Try not to over mix
  • Gently fold in the pineapple.
  • Scoop into the lined muffin tin and bake for 15-20 minutes, checking with a toothpick for doneness
  • Let cool for 10 minutes

PINEAPPLE-GINGER MUFFINS



Pineapple-Ginger Muffins image

Make and share this Pineapple-Ginger Muffins rec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Diana Adcock

Categories     Quick Breads

Time 35m

Yield 12 Muffins

Number Of Ingredients 16

1 (14 ounce) can crushed pineapple
3/4 cup brown sugar
1/4 cup melted butter
1/4 cup liquid honey
1 teaspoon minced fresh ginger
1 1/2 cups flour
1/2 cup wheat germ
1 teaspoon baking powder
1 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up brown sugar
1 egg
1 teaspoon minced ginger
1 cup plain low-fat yogurt
1/4 cup vegetable oil
2 teaspoons liquid honey

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375*F degrees.
  • --------Topping--------.
  • Grease 12 large muffin cups.
  • Place 1 Tbsp of crushed pineapple in each tin.
  • Then place in each tin 1 Tbsp brown sugar, 1 Tbsp butter, mix together honey and ginger and add 1 Tbsp to each tin.
  • ----------Muffins--------------.
  • Stir flour with wheat germ, baking powder and soda, and salt in a large mixing bowl.
  • Stir in sugar.
  • Whisk egg with yogurt, oil, ginger and honey.
  • Pour into flour mixture and stir until just combined.
  • Spoon batter into muffin tins on top of the pineapple mixture.
  • Bake in the center of preheated oven and tops are golden-around 25 minutes.
  • Cool for 5 minutes.
  • Flip to remove and serve warm.

DELICIOUS PINEAPPLE MUFFINS



Delicious Pineapple Muffins image

A moist muffin with a brown sugar and cinnamon topping.

Provided by ACPHIFER

Categories     Bread     Quick Bread Recipes     Muffin Recipes

Time 45m

Yield 16

Number Of Ingredients 12

2 cups all-purpose flour
½ cup white sugar
1 tablespoon baking powder
½ teaspoon salt
1 (8 ounce) can crushed pineapple
1 egg, beaten
¾ cup milk
¼ cup butter, melted
¼ cup butter, melted
¼ teaspoon ground cinnamon
⅓ cup packed brown sugar
½ cup all-purpose flour

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Grease and flour muffin pans, or line with paper liners.
  • In a large bowl, stir together 2 cups flour, white sugar, baking powder and salt. Drain pineapple, reserving 1/4 cup juice. Make a well in the center of the dry ingredients, and pour in the reserved juice, egg, milk, and 1/4 cup melted butter. Mix just until blended.
  • In a separate bowl, stir together the cinnamon, brown sugar, 1/2 cup flour, and 1/4 cup melted butter to make the topping.
  • Spoon batter into muffin cups, then spoon crushed pineapple over the batter and sprinkle with the cinnamon topping.
  • Bake for 30 minutes in the preheated oven, until a toothpick inserted in the crown of the muffin comes out clean.

PINEAPPLE SUNSHINE MUFFINS



Pineapple Sunshine Muffins image

Even though my children are grown, they still look for these muffins on Sunday mornings. I put the leftovers, if any, in my husband's lunch for a surprise treat.

Provided by Taste of Home

Time 25m

Yield 1 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 cups all-purpose flour
1 cup sugar
2 teaspoons baking powder
1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on ground ginger
2 eggs
1/2 cup butter
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 can (8 ounces) crushed pineapple, undrained
1/2 cup shredded carrot
1/2 cup sunflower kernels

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ine the flour, sugar, baking powder, cinnamon and ginger. In another bowl, whisk the eggs, butter and vanilla; stir in pineapple. Stir into dry ingredients just until moistened. Fold in carrot and sunflower kernels. , Fill greased or paper-lined muffin cups three fourths full. Bake at 375° for 15-20 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ean. Cool for 5 minutes before removing from pan to a wire rack. Serve warm.

SWEET PINEAPPLE MUFFINS



Sweet Pineapple Muffins image

These pineapple muffins make an excellent breakfast treat or dessert. Kids and adults alike will be scarfing them down.-Tina Hanson, Portage, Wisconsin

Provided by Taste of Home

Time 25m

Yield about 20 muffins.

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 cups all-purpose flour
2 cups sugar
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on baking powder
2 cans (8 ounces each) crushed pineapple, undrained
2 eggs
1/2 cup canola oil

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ine flour, sugar, baking soda and baking powder. In another bowl, mix pineapple, eggs and oil; stir into the dry ingredients just until moistened. , Fill greased or paper-lined muffin cups two-thirds full. Bake at 350° for 20-25 minutes or until muffins test done. Cool in pans for 10 minutes before removing to wire racks.
